Ingredients for Pierogi Dill Soup

Here’s what you’ll need to make this delicious Pierogi Dill Soup:

1 tbsp vegetable oil – for sautéing and adding depth to the flavors.

11 ounces kielbasa – sliced; the hearty, smoky sausage adds robust flavor.

1 yellow onion – diced; adds sweetness and richness to the broth.

2 carrots – peeled and cut into half-moons; for a sweet crunch and vibrant color.

1 garlic clove – minced; for that aromatic kick.

1 tsp sweet paprika – for a subtle warmth and color.

1 tsp ground cumin – to enhance the savory notes of the soup.

5 cups chicken broth – the base of the soup; choose low-sodium for more control over saltiness.

¼ head savoy cabbage – cored and chopped; provides texture and body to the soup.

3 tbsp cheese spread – at room temperature; adds creaminess and rich flavor.

12 pierogi – cheese and potato filling; the stars of the show, bringing comfort and heartiness.

3 tbsp chopped fresh dill – for a burst of freshness and flavor.

Freshly ground black pepper – to taste, enhancing all the flavors beautifully.

How to Make Pierogi Dill Soup

Follow these simple steps to prepare this delicious Pierogi Dill Soup:

Step 1: Prepare Your Ingredients
Before cooking, slice the kielbasa, peel the carrots, mince the garlic, dice the onion, core and chop the cabbage, and chop the dill. Having everything ready makes the process smooth and enjoyable.

Step 2: Sauté the Kielbasa
In a large pot, heat the vegetable oil over medium heat. Add the sliced kielbasa and cook until browned, about 5 minutes. This step is where all those rich, flavorful oils start to build!

Step 3: Add the Aromatics
Remove the kielbasa from the pot, and in the same pot, add the garlic, onion, and carrots. Sauté for about 3 minutes until the vegetables soften, then stir in the sweet paprika and cumin for a fragrant kick.

Step 4: Simmer the Broth
Pour the chicken broth into the pot and bring it to a boil. Once boiling, add the chopped cabbage, cover the pot, and reduce the heat to medium-low. Let it simmer for about 10 minutes to meld all those delicious flavors together.

Step 5: Add the Creamy Cheese
Remove the pot lid, and stir in the cheese spread, allowing it to melt and blend into the soup. Increase the heat to medium-high, then gently add the pierogi. Boil until they start to float—this can take about 3-5 minutes for fresh pierogi and up to 8 minutes for frozen ones.

Step 6: Combine and Finish
Turn off the heat, and stir back in the browned kielbasa and chopped dill. Finish with a sprinkle of freshly ground black pepper, and there you have it—your delicious Pierogi Dill Soup, ready to warm your heart!

Storing & Reheating Pierogi Dill Soup

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ge for up to three days. To reheat, gently warm on the stove until heated through for the best flavor and texture.

Can I make Pierogi Dill Soup vegetarian?

Absolutely! To create a vegetarian version of Pierogi Dill Soup, simply omit the kielbasa and use vegetable broth instead of chicken broth. You can add additional vegetables such as mushrooms, zucchini, or bell peppers for added flavor and texture. Instead of cheese-filled pierogi, look for vegetarian options or make your own filled with potatoes and cheese. This way, you will still enjoy a delicious, hearty soup without the meat.

How do I store Pierogi Dill Soup?

Storing Pierogi Dill Soup is simple. Allow the soup to cool down before transferring it to an airtight container. You can store it in the refrigerator for up to three days. If you want to store it for a more extended period, consider freezing individual portions. Just make sure to leave some space in the container, as liquids expand when frozen. When you’re ready to enjoy it again, reheat gently on the stove for the best taste and texture.
